Types of AA Meetings Available in Washoe Valley

Open Meetings: Anyone interested in learning about AA can attend, including family members, friends, and those curious about the program.

Closed Meetings: Reserved for individuals who have a desire to stop drinking. These meetings offer a more intimate setting for sharing.

Speaker Meetings: One or more members share their experience, strength, and hope with the group.

Discussion Meetings: Members discuss a topic related to recovery, with everyone having an opportunity to share.

Big Book/Step Study: Focused study of AA literature including the Big Book and the 12 Steps.

Beginner Meetings: Specifically designed for newcomers who may be attending their first meetings. These groups provide extra guidance on how AA works, the 12 Steps, and getting a sponsor.

Online/Virtual Meetings: Participate from anywhere via video or phone. Virtual listings can help when travel, mobility, or scheduling makes an in-person meeting difficult.
